val emptyOnDelete: Output<Boolean>? = null

If true, deleting the repository force deletes the contents of the repository. If false, the repository must be empty before attempting to delete it. If true, deleting the repository force deletes the contents of the repository. Without a force delete, you can only delete empty repositories.

The encryption configuration for the repository. This determines how the contents of your repository are encrypted at rest. The encryption configuration for the repository. This determines how the contents of your repository are encrypted at rest. By default, when no encryption configuration is set or the `AES256` encryption type is used, Amazon ECR uses server-side encryption with Amazon S3-managed encryption keys which encrypts your data at rest using an AES-256 encryption algorithm. This does not require any action on your part. For more control over the encryption of the contents of your repository, you can use server-side encryption with KMSlong key stored in KMSlong (KMS) to encrypt your images. For more information, see Amazon ECR encryption at rest in the Amazon Elastic Container Registry User Guide.

val imageTagMutability: Output<Either<String, ImageTagMutability>>? = null

The tag mutability setting for the repository. If this parameter is omitted, the default setting of `MUTABLE` will be used which will allow image tags to be overwritten. If `IMMUTABLE` is specified, all image tags within the repository will be immutable which will prevent them from being overwritten.

val repositoryName: Output<String>? = null

The name to use for the repository. The repository name may be specified on its own (such as `nginx-web-app`) or it can be prepended with a namespace to group the repository into a category (such as `project-a/nginx-web-app`). If you don't specify a name, CFNlong generates a unique physical ID and uses that ID for the repository name. For more information, see Name type. The repository name must start with a letter and can only contain lowercase letters, numbers, hyphens, underscores, and forward slashes. If you specify a name, you cannot perform updates that require replacement of this resource. You can perform updates that require no or some interruption. If you must replace the resource, specify a new name.
